Coast Guard rescues boater in distress

The Coast Guard assisted a boater on board a 17-foot fishing vessel taking on water in Cedar Bayou in the vicinity of the Fred Hartman Bridge.

Watchstanders at Sector Houston-Galveston received a call from the Galveston County Sheriff's Office reporting a 17-foot white angler fishing boat taking on water. The operator of the boat reported that waves had overtaken the boat and the bilge pump on board had malfunctioned.

A 25-foot response boat from Coast Guard Sector Houston-Galveston boathouse and a Coast Guard Air Station Houston MH-65C rescue helicopter crew were both launched to assist the boater.

The 25-foot response boat arrived on scene and safely towed the 17-foot white angler to a landing at Crowley's. No injuries were reported.
